About this home

Built in 2022, this stunning home features 5 bedrooms, 3.5 bathrooms, duel owner's suites, one upstairs and one downstairs with tiled showers and quartz vanity tops. Open concept living area with large kitchen including quartz counter tops, stainless appliances and an island large enough for seating. 9' ceilings, walk-in closets w/ wood shelving, 2 car garage & fenced backyard overlooking one of the community lakes. Neighborhood amenities include a community center w/ kitchen & great room for resident use or to reserve for private party, resort-style pool w/ outdoor kitchen & cabana, 24/7 fitness & playground, walking trails & 5 community lakes. Desirable Hickory school zone. Pets are welcome on case by case basis with $25 monthly pet rent + $250 non-refundable pet fee. Sorry no smoking of any kind on premises.

HICKORY MANOR and the Chesapeake real estate market

Chesapeake is one of the largest cities by land area on the East Coast, and it consistently ranks among Virginia's most livable communities. The southern reaches near zip code 23322 have a suburban character — wide streets, newer construction, and a pace that feels a step removed from the bustle of downtown Norfolk without sacrificing access to it. Grocery stores, fitness centers, and quick-service dining are all within half a mile of Briton Lane, which means daily errands rarely turn into an event. The broader Chesapeake community is home to a strong mix of military families, long-term residents, and buyers drawn by the quality of life the area offers. If you're exploring new homes in Chesapeake, this part of the city tends to attract people who want modern construction with a neighborhood feel — and 1920 Briton Lane fits that profile well.

Hickory

Hickory is a rural-meets-suburban community in the southern reaches of Chesapeake, Virginia, set along the Battlefield Boulevard South corridor as it runs toward the North Carolina line.
